PDF Datastream.pdf
从给定的文件信息中,我们可以了解到一些与Mie散射计算相关的知识点。Mie散射是电磁波(例如光)与粒子相互作用时产生的现象,其描述了当光束通过包含微小粒子的介质时散射光线的分布。Mie散射尤其重要,因为它能够解释为何天空是蓝色的,以及为什么当太阳位于地平线附近时天空是红色的。下面详细介绍文件中隐含的几个相关知识点: 1. Mie散射的历史与早期算法:文档中提到,Dave在1968年发表了第一个广泛使用的Mie散射代码。这表明Mie散射理论和相关计算方法早在20世纪中期就已经被发展出来,并且对于科学计算来说至关重要。由于Mie散射在计算上往往需要大量的时间,这激发了对提高计算效率的持续探索。 2. 技术改进和向量化处理:随着时间的发展,对Mie散射计算的技术进行了若干改进。作者Warren J. Wiscombe报告了一些新的进展,并强调了向量化处理对于现代科学计算机器的重要性。向量化处理是指利用向量处理器快速处理数据流的能力,显著提升了处理速度和计算效率。 3. 新的Mie散射计算代码:为了适应现代计算的需求,作者提出并整合了技术改进和向量化处理的代码,产生了新的Mie散射计算代码。文档中介绍了两种代码,分别是MIEVO和MIEV1。MIEVO在尽可能少的内存占用约束下达到最大向量化速度,适合在几乎任何类型的计算机上使用,而且设计上通常比现有的Mie代码更快速和更优良。MIEV1则在牺牲内存占用量的情况下达到最高向量化速度,适合向量处理计算机使用,对于CRAY-1这类向量处理机的计算速度要比MIEVO快10%到300%。两个代码都经过了充分的测试和文档化,并且可靠性和稳定性非常优秀。 4. 计算机代码与数值模拟:上述提到的代码可以被理解为数值模拟的工具,它们对于研究者来说是模拟Mie散射现象时不可或缺的资源。数值模拟允许科学家通过计算机模拟来研究物理过程,而无需实际进行实验,这可以大大减少资源消耗并加快研究进程。 5. 光学参数的计算:文档中的代码能够处理到20,000的大小参数,意味着这些代码可以处理从非常小到相对较大的粒子尺寸。在气象学、大气科学、物理学、材料科学等领域,研究者往往需要根据粒子的大小、形状以及所处介质的光学特性来精确计算Mie散射,以预测其对光的散射和吸收效应。 6. 代码的普适性和实用性:文档中表明,所提到的代码不仅适用于特定的计算环境,它们能够被广泛地应用到包括向量处理机在内的各种现代计算设备上。这使得Mie散射的计算更为方便和高效,为各个领域的研究者提供了强有力的计算支持。 7. 大气辐射传输的研究:文档中作者还提到了自己在大气辐射传输方面的研究依赖于Mie散射计算。这说明Mie散射理论是理解大气散射和辐射传输等物理过程的基础之一,并且在气候模型、遥感技术以及其他需要对大气成分进行监测和分析的领域中有着广泛的应用。 通过理解这份文件提供的信息,我们可以得到关于Mie散射计算、数值模拟、计算机编程优化以及在物理学和大气科学中应用的深刻见解。此外,文档强调了技术创新在提高科学计算效率方面的关键作用,这对于IT行业和科学研究者都是极其宝贵的资料。
剩余97页未读,继续阅读
- 粉丝: 0
- 资源: 1
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助